Sugaring

Sugaring refers to either adding sugar to a dish, or covering a specific foodstuff with sugar. Covering a foodstuff (ie fruit) with sugar forms a barrier to microbes, bacteria preventing them from multiplying quickly, hence increasing the shelf life of the foodstuff.
